Comment 8 Lorinc Czegledi 2006-06-04 02:36:37 UTC
(In reply to comment #7)
> *** Bug 135481 has been marked as a duplicate of this bug. ***
> 
there's a working ebuild over there... attached ;)

to sum up the relevant proposed changes:


mod_security-1.9.4.ebuild could be used nicely, if the MY_P variable gets a
little tuning, due to source-file name change:

MY_P="${P/mod_security-/modsecurity-apache_}" 

should be the now correct MY_P line for version 1.9.4: (only the "-" and "_")
need adding to the present 1.9.2.ebuild...
